🔁 What is Remarketing?

Remarketing is the practice of showing targeted ads to users who have previously interacted with your website, app, or digital platforms. It could be someone who:

  • Added a product to cart but didn’t check out
  • Read your blog but didn’t subscribe
  • Viewed a service page but didn’t enquire

Instead of letting that potential customer slip away, remarketing lets you stay top-of-mind—through display ads, social media, search, and even email marketing.


📈 Why Remarketing Works

Remarketing helps you reach people who are already somewhat familiar with your brand. That familiarity translates into:

  • Higher click-through rates (CTR)
  • Lower cost-per-click (CPC)
  • Better conversion rates
  • Improved ROI

Instead of fishing in the vast ocean of cold traffic, you’re re-engaging the warm leads—people who already showed intent.


🎯 6 Powerful Remarketing Strategies to Boost Engagement and ROI

Let’s explore how you can use remarketing effectively to keep your audience engaged and your marketing dollars well-spent.


1. Segment Your Audience Based on Behavior

Not all website visitors are at the same stage of the buyer journey. One-size-fits-all ads won’t work here. Instead, create custom audiences based on how people interact with your content:

  • Visited a specific landing page
  • Watched 75% of a video ad
  • Downloaded a brochure
  • Abandoned their cart

Tailoring your messaging based on this behavior results in more relevant ads and higher conversion chances.

🧠 Example: Show a time-limited discount to cart abandoners, or a testimonial video to those who viewed your pricing page.


2. Utilize Dynamic Remarketing for E-Commerce

Dynamic remarketing takes personalization to the next level. These ads automatically show users the exact products they viewed on your website, along with pricing, images, and even availability.

Why is this effective? It taps into recency and relevance. If someone’s been eyeing a specific pair of shoes or skincare item, seeing that same product again in their feed can be the final nudge they need to purchase.


3. Cross-Platform Remarketing Campaigns

Your potential customers live across multiple platforms—so your remarketing should too. Here’s how you can expand your reach:

  • Google Display Network – Great for visual ads that follow users across millions of websites.
  • Facebook & Instagram – Ideal for storytelling and lifestyle-focused creatives.
  • YouTube – Perfect for brand recall and showcasing explainer videos.
  • TikTok & LinkedIn – For niche targeting depending on your audience.

An integrated, multi-platform strategy ensures that your message stays consistent wherever your audience goes.


4. Time It Right – Frequency & Timing Matter

Remarketing ads can quickly go from helpful to annoying if they’re shown too frequently. That’s why timing and frequency caps are essential.

  • Set a lookback window based on your sales cycle. (E.g., 7 days for fast-moving products, 30 days for high-ticket items)
  • Limit impressions to avoid ad fatigue.
  • Use sequential messaging—first show a testimonial, then follow up with a special offer.

💡 Pro tip: Remarketing is most effective within the first 3–7 days after a user visits your site.


5. Incorporate Content That Adds Value

Not everyone is ready to buy—but they might be ready to learn more. Use content-based remarketing to educate and nurture potential customers.

Ideas include:

  • Blog posts that address their pain points
  • Product comparisons or FAQs
  • Customer reviews or success stories
  • Behind-the-scenes or “how it works” videos

This builds trust and keeps your brand in the conversation—without being pushy.


6. Measure, Test, and Refine

Like any marketing strategy, your remarketing campaigns should be guided by data, not guesswork. Monitor:

  • CTR and conversion rates
  • Cost per conversion
  • Bounce rates
  • View-through conversions (users who saw your ad but converted later)

Run A/B tests on creative formats, call-to-action buttons, audience segments, and timing windows. Over time, even small tweaks can significantly improve your ROI.
